The Safety Sensor — Why It's the Right Place to Start

The Safety Sensor — Why It's the Right Place to Start in Remington, IN

How the Sensor System Creates the Closing Condition in Remington

The safety sensor system consists of a transmitter and a receiver mounted at the bottom of the door opening on each side in Remington, IN. The transmitter sends a continuous infrared beam to the receiver in Remington. When the receiver detects the full beam, it sends a continuous confirmation signal to the opener's logic board indicating a clear path in Remington, IN. The logic board will complete the closing cycle only while this confirmation signal is continuously present in Remington. Any interruption of the signal causes the logic board to reverse the door immediately in Remington, IN.

The Four LED States and What Each One Means in Remington, IN

There are four possible LED states across the two sensors that EZ Open reads on arrival in Remington. Both LEDs solid indicates correct sensor alignment and function in Remington, IN. Receiver LED blinking, transmitter LED solid indicates sensor misalignment or a beam obstruction in Remington. Receiver LED off, transmitter LED solid indicates no power to the receiver, which points to a wiring fault or receiver failure in Remington, IN. Both LEDs off indicates no power to either sensor, which points to the sensor wiring connection at the opener control board in Remington.

Misalignment vs Component Failure — How to Tell the Difference in Remington

A blinking receiver LED indicates the receiver isn't detecting the full beam from the transmitter in Remington, IN. This can mean the sensor bracket has rotated out of the correct alignment or the sensor component itself has failed in Remington. To distinguish between the two, EZ Open gently adjusts the receiver bracket through its full range of angles while watching the LED in Remington, IN. If the LED becomes solid at any angle, the sensor is functional but misaligned in Remington. If the LED stays blinking through the full range of bracket adjustment, the sensor itself has failed and requires replacement in Remington, IN.

Why Sunlight Can Produce the Exact Same Symptom as a Failed Sensor in Remington, IN

Direct sunlight contains infrared radiation at intensities that can overwhelm the receiver's ability to distinguish the transmitter's signal from the background in Remington. When direct sunlight hits the receiver lens at a specific angle, the receiver can't confirm the transmitter's beam against the solar infrared background in Remington, IN. The opener reverses the door exactly as it would for a misaligned sensor or a physical obstruction in Remington. A door that won't close only at specific times of day when the sun is at a particular angle is almost certainly experiencing solar interference in Remington, IN.

When Sensor Replacement Is Actually Required in Remington

Sensor replacement is required when the receiver LED stays blinking through the full range of bracket adjustment with no obstruction between the sensors in Remington, IN. This confirms the receiver's internal photoelectric component has failed in Remington. Sensor replacement is also required when the LED is completely off indicating power supply failure at the sensor unit in Remington, IN. EZ Open carries replacement sensors compatible with all major opener brands in Remington.

Every Cause of a Garage Door That Won't Close

Every Cause of a Garage Door That Won't Close in Remington, IN

Sensor Misalignment — Most Common Cause in Remington

The sensor bracket on one or both sensors has rotated away from the correct beam angle in Remington, IN. Physical contact from a person or object, vibration from door operation over time, or accidental contact during garage use are the most common causes in Remington. The receiver LED blinks or is dim rather than solid in Remington, IN. Bracket adjustment until the receiver LED becomes solid resolves misalignment in most cases in Remington.

Sensor Failure — Less Common but More Expensive in Remington, IN

A sensor component that has failed internally produces the same LED behavior as misalignment but doesn't resolve with bracket adjustment in Remington. The receiver LED stays blinking regardless of the bracket angle in Remington, IN. Replacement with a compatible sensor unit is required in Remington. EZ Open distinguishes between misalignment and failure through the bracket adjustment test before recommending any sensor replacement in Remington, IN.

Down-Travel Limit Set Too High in Remington

The down-travel limit setting tells the opener when to stop the closing cycle in Remington, IN. A limit set too high stops the opener before the door reaches the floor in Remington. The door stops short of the floor without reversing in Remington, IN. This is often confused with a sensor fault but produces a distinctly different symptom, the door stops rather than reverses in Remington. A limit calibration adjustment resolves this cause immediately in Remington, IN.

Physical Obstruction at the Door Path in Remington

An object in the door's path at floor level triggers the same reversal response as a misaligned sensor in Remington, IN. The door contacts the object before reaching the floor and the opener reverses in Remington. A floor mat that's shifted into the door path. A tool or piece of equipment near the door edge. Debris at the door threshold in Remington, IN. Removing the obstruction resolves the cause in Remington.

Spring Imbalance Triggering Force Limit in Remington, IN

A spring that has lost significant tension produces a heavier door in Remington. The heavier door requires more closing force from the opener in Remington, IN. If the required closing force exceeds the opener's force limit setting, the opener stops before the door reaches the floor in Remington. This produces a door that stops short without reversing in Remington, IN. Spring assessment and replacement where indicated alongside force limit recalibration addresses this cause in Remington.

Damaged Wiring Between Sensor and Opener in Remington, IN

The low-voltage wiring connecting each sensor to the opener control board runs from the sensor bracket up the door frame and along the ceiling to the opener in Remington. Damage at any point along this run, from a staple that pierced the wire, a rodent that chewed through it, or physical disturbance that cut or kinked it, can produce sensor symptoms that appear identical to sensor failure or misalignment in Remington, IN. EZ Open inspects the complete wiring run where sensor LED behavior doesn't clearly indicate misalignment or component failure in Remington.

Logic Board Fault Producing Erratic Closing Behavior in Remington, IN

A logic board with a failing component can produce erratic closing behavior including random reversals at inconsistent points in the close cycle, failure to initiate the close cycle despite correct sensor and limit settings, and stopping mid-cycle for no identifiable physical reason in Remington. Logic board faults are the least common cause of won't-close behavior and are the last step in the diagnostic hierarchy in Remington, IN. They're identified after sensor, limit, physical obstruction, and spring balance have been ruled out in Remington.

Use a soft, dry, lint-free cloth to gently wipe the lens of each sensor in Remington. Avoid using water, glass cleaner, or any abrasive material, since the lens coating can be sensitive in Remington, IN. Check that both sensors are free of cobwebs, dust buildup, and any obstruction directly in the beam path between them in Remington. If cleaning doesn't resolve a blinking LED, the issue is likely alignment or a component fault rather than dirt in Remington, IN.
